Old Gods of Appalachia Roleplaying Game (Monte Cook Games)Monte Cook Games currently has a crowdfunding project to bring the award-winning eldritch horror podcast Old Gods of Appalachia to your tabletop. Powered by the Cypher System, the Old Gods of Appalachia Roleplaying Game promises plenty of 1920s-1930s backwoods chills and thrills. There’s even a primer to help you learn more about the RPG. The Kickstarter project is already well past the $1 million funding mark and you can reserve a copy of the corebook for a $70 pledge through May 6th. Expected delivery is March 2023.

The Old Gods of Appalachia Roleplaying Game is a complete standalone tabletop RPG driven by the Cypher System, the popular, critically acclaimed game engine lauded for its elegance, ease of use, flexibility, and narrative focus. Intuitive character creation, fast-paced gameplay, and a uniquely GM-friendly design make the Cypher System perfect for the world of Old Gods of Appalachia, and a joy to run and play.

Cypher System characters are built from the concept up. A descriptive sentence provides not just an easily-understood overview of the character, but also the mechanical basis for skills, abilities, and stats. And the Cypher System gives players amazing narrative engagement, rewarding player-driven subplots and giving players resources to bear on the tasks and situations they most want to succeed at.
